Cervicogenic Headache is the type of headache most likely triggered by spondylolisthesis, however, Migraine can sometimes be triggered by cervicogenic headache and the muscle tension it may cause. For proper diagnosis and treatment of your headache, seek the help of a headache specialist or other physician.

The "dents" in your skull are the joints between the different bones that compose it. They do not cause migraines.

Spondylolisthesis occurs when a bone from the lower spine (a vertebra) slips out of position.
